The recent announcement that Sony will cease production of discs from 2028 has sent shockwaves through the gaming community, with many fans taking to social media to express their discontent. Unfortunately, indie developers have become unintended targets of the backlash, with some being unfairly attacked and criticized.

The situation has been exacerbated by PlayStation's practice of retweeting posts from independent developers, which has led some fans to mistakenly assume that these devs are somehow responsible for the decision to stop making discs.
